Dania Tamimi, BDS, DMSc
Dr. Dania Tamimi is a board-certified oral and maxillofacial radiologist with a DMSc from Harvard School of Dental Medicine. She is a Fellow of the International College of Dentists, the Pierre Fauchard Academy, and an honorary Fellow of the Royal College of Physicians and Surgeons (Glasgow). Dr. Tamimi is lead author of several imaging textbooks and serves on editorial boards for major dental journals. She lectures internationally and runs a private radiology practice in Orlando, Florida.
Session title: How to Read a CBCT – Looking at the Big Picture
This isn’t your typical radiology lecture. Dr. Tamimi takes a holistic, systems-aware approach to CBCT interpretation, exploring how craniofacial anatomy connects to the body as a whole. Learn how to navigate 3D data, extract diagnostic insights from anatomy, and apply radiographic clues to create sound, patient-centered treatment plans.

Teresa A. (Terri) Dolan, DDS, MPH
Dr. Terri Dolan is Chief Dental Officer at Overjet and former Dean of the University of Florida College of Dentistry. With more than 35 years of experience in clinical practice, education, and industry leadership, she brings a deep commitment to innovation, equity, and patient-centered care. A champion of women in dentistry, Dr. Dolan serves as President-Elect of the Santa Fe Group and Vice President of the American College of Dentists, and has received multiple honors for her leadership in global education and industry innovation.
Session title: Beyond the Mouth: Reimagining Oral-Systemic Health through Technology and Integration
This keynote will examine the critical connections between oral health and systemic disease, revealing how traditional silos between medical and dental care have created missed opportunities for comprehensive patient management. Dr. Dolan will explore how emerging AI technologies and integrated health systems can bridge these gaps, transforming both dental education and clinical practice to better serve patients’ overall health needs. The presentation will provide actionable strategies for implementing technology-driven solutions that enable medical-dental collaboration. Attendees will gain insights into the future of integrated healthcare delivery, where dental practices become essential partners in health monitoring and disease prevention.

Earn up to 13 CEs

The American Association of Women Dentists is designated as an Approved PACE Program Provider by the Academy of General Dentistry. The formal continuing education programs of this program provider are accepted by AGD for Fellowship, Mastership and membership maintenance credit. Approval does not imply acceptance by a state or provincial board of dentistry or the AGD endorsement. The current term of approval extends from January 1, 2024, to December 31, 2027, Provider ID #218170.
